Job Summary: The Facilities Fire Systems Technician – Level 5 performs advanced inspection, testing, maintenance, troubleshooting, and technical oversight of fire protection and life-safety systems to ensure system reliability, operational readiness, and full regulatory compliance across the site. Serving as a senior technical resource within the Facilities organization, this role provides subject matter expertise for fire alarm, detection, suppression, and related infrastructure systems; leads complex diagnostics and system restoration efforts; and establishes technical standards and best practices. This position includes fire brigade support responsibilities in addition to primary fire systems duties, responding to fire alarms, thermal events, and other emergency situations as part of the site brigade while continuing to support overall facility operations. Because this is not a full-time standby fire position, emergency response may require transitioning from active facility work, securing work areas, accessing response equipment and protective gear, and deploying to the incident scene as needed. Working independently with limited oversight, this position collaborates with internal teams, contractors, local authorities, and regulatory representatives to ensure safe, compliant, and resilient facility operations.
